Key Features of the atolla USB 3.0 Hub
- 4-Port Functionality: This hub features four USB 3.0 ports, enabling simultaneous connections for your devices. Enjoy enhanced productivity as you connect printers, external drives, and other devices all at once.
- High-Speed Data Transfer: Experience fast data transfer rates of up to 5 Gigabits per second. Move large files effortlessly and reduce waiting time significantly.
- Electronic Switch: Each port comes equipped with an intelligent electronic switch. This feature allows you to turn ports on and off as needed, helping to save power and extend the lifespan of connected devices.
- Lightweight and Portable: Weighing only 90 grams and compactly designed (4.13″L x 1.65″W x 0.87″H), the atolla USB hub is perfect for travel or home use. Fits easily in your laptop bag.
- Universal Compatibility: Compatible with a wide range of operating systems, including Windows (8.1 and above), Mac, Linux, and Vista. This hub works seamlessly across different platforms.
- Intelligent Charging Port: One of the ports has an intelligent charging feature, allowing for quick charging of mobile devices without compromising data transfer on the other ports.

I don’t know what it is about me and USB, but I never seem to have enough ports. I bought this to replace a round hub I used to have which had a casing that fell apart within a few months (but I stubbornly kept on using it anyway). Eventually, the ports themselves started to fail, so I finally caved and looked for a new one. Let me tell you, having a strip of ports is so much better than a round hub. Instead of having cords sticking every direction, it fits behind my monitor nice, slim, and covert but is still easy to access. I also never thought having the “on/off” switches would be so handy as well. My old hub didn’t have that, but it’s really useful for some USB lights I have that don’t have an “on/off” switch themselves. Beats having to plug and unplug them every use. I also tend to turn off the power to my webcam when I’m not using it for peace of mind (yes, I’m paranoid). The speed so far also seems to be pretty great for most things–though, my portable backup drive copied way too slow for me through this hub, so I transferred it to my direct ports instead. Otherwise, a great buy for the price. I’m actually considering getting another one because… (see title).

This usb hub is compact and very nice. I like the fact that the cord is attached on the shorter side because it allows me to place it right next to my laptop where my desk is very crowded. I’ve seen those that have cord coming out on the longer side, and I assume it takes up more space than it’s actual size. Anyhow, it’s been working great for the past 5months, and I like the idea of on/off feature on each port because I don’t have to pull it out completely just to turn it off where I’m going to use it very soon again anyways. I believe pulling it out does some wear on the hardware of the usb. It’s small enough and lightweight. Also, the ports are parallel to each other and not lined up in a series and I think it’s definitely a plus in a practical way because if the usbs were wider in its body size, they would be competing for space (even though there are more than one port you’d have to skip one or something) if the ports were lined up. That’s not a concern with this hub. Lastly, the charging port is fancy and I can just connect it for charging without worrying about it being actually connected to my computer. So far, it’s been great in doing what it’s supposed to do and I’m satisfied with it. I have not found a major fault in it so far. Would recommend to my friends and family.

It works pretty well; haven’t put any serious demand on it so far, with multiple devices. It took a few few tries to get the individual ports to power off, you have to hold the power button longer than you think. Naturally, turning it back on, it comes on instantly. I guess that’s not too unreasonable, since I’ve experienced issues with power buttons that were too sensitive and would turn off if you brushed passed them; so it’s not a bad idea to make it so, if you’re going to turn these ports off, it has to be intentional.
It’s not great for phone charging. I imagine it might be better if it came with a power supply and the hub itself was plugged in. I’m not sure why it doesn’t come with one, since it does have a DC adapter port. But it is connected to a USB 3 port, which I had hoped would have made some difference for charging speed.
The charging ability is a little disappointing, especially since it even has a designated charging port on the end, that port still doesn’t put out much juice to charge a phone very well.

It’s nice to give a review for product that actually turns out to be exactly as it promises. This Atolla USB hub is exactly what I was looking for. I have several devices, including a microphone headset and several external backup drives. Once the headset is plugged in it overrides the computer speakers. Many times when I forget to unplug it I end up fiddling with the speakers, until sanity takes its course and I realize what the problem is. You’d think I would learn after several times, but well we’re only human. As for the external drives, if I soft-boot or reboot my computer, the computer will read the external drives as if they are the internal drive and not re-boot. Therefore you have to remember to disconnect the two external drives every time you want to reboot. That was a pain as well. And I actually did need some additional USB ports for other uses, having used up the ports on the computer. So I was delighted to see that not only does this have four ports and is designed to sit nicely on your desk next to your computer, but that each port has a switch next to it, so that you can turn it off and on even when it is still connected. Cooler still, when pressed, a blue LED lights up. This way of course I can keep all of these devices plugged in and simply hit the switch. It works perfectly, and is beautifully constructed and looks great. By the way, it also has another port on the side, specifically for charging. It’s a nice addition, though the other ports will charge devices as well. I’m not a big tech nerd, but I believe the difference is that the charge port may have a power limiter or fuse. Something honestly that is truly not a problem, unless you’re using the port to charge a power tool or a Toyota Echo! Nice to get something, as I said that meets if not exceeds expectations.
